Company Announcements Biotage AB expanded its outsourcing collaboration with PartnerTech, which will take over most instrument manufacturing. Running initially through 2011, the agreement is worth approximately SEK 40 million ($5 million) annually. Manufacturing will be relocated from Charlottesville, Virginia, to Åtvidaberg, Sweden. Many biologic drugs, such as antibodies and proteins, and vaccines are produced through the large-scale culturing of mammalian cells. From R&D through screening and production, bioprocess cell culturing must be carefully monitored and regulated to optimize growth conditions, control feeding and prevent contamination. GE Healthcare and Geron announced this week that they are partnering to offer human embryonic stem cell (hESC)-derived assays for drug development and screening toxicity (see page 2). HESC-derived cell-based assays promise to supplement in vivo animal and in vitro cell testing for drug development. Company Announcements In March, Real Time Genomics, a US subsidiary of NetValue, received a $3 million investment from Catamount Ventures. Real Time Genomics provides the SLIM Search sequence-comparison technology for genomic mapping and alignment functions that are tolerant of mismatches. Company Announcements Exiqon’s Research Product sales grew 43% in 2008. Exiqon expects the business to be cash flow positive by the end of 2009. Norgen Biotek signed an OEM manufacturing and supply agreement to supply Exiqon with RNA purification kits. As more protein-based therapeutics and biologics enter the drug development pipeline, the demand for technologies for immunogenicity testing is expected to become increasingly important.
